ON A THEORY CONCERNING THE DYNAMICAL BEHAVIOR OF STRUCTURES CARRYING MOVING MASSES
Two new methods are presented in order to determine the behavior of a structure carrying moving masses. The first method is analytic in nature and represents a modified asymptotic method in the theory of nonlinear phenomena. The second method is an exact numerical technique general enough to be used for solving exactly a set of differential equations with singular coefficients. The results show that the analytical method is in excellent agreement with the exact one obtained by means of a numerical technique. Furthermore, it is shown that the effect of the response of the structure to the moving mass has to be properly considered.
